在当今的互联网时代,个人网站不仅是展示自我的平台,更是记录学习与成长的重要工具。而GitHub作为一个流行的版本控制工具,提供了极佳的方式来创建和托管个人网站。本文将带你详细了解如何利用GitHub创建网站的整个过程。
什么是GitHub?
GitHub是一个基于Git的版本控制系统,允许开发者在一个公共或私人库中托管和共享代码。除了代码管理功能外,GitHub还提供了GitHub Pages,使用户能够轻松地托管个人网站或项目页面。
创建GitHub账号
在开始之前,第一步是创建一个GitHub账号。
- 访问GitHub官网。
- 点击右上角的“Sign up”按钮。
- 填写所需信息,包括用户名、邮箱和密码。
- 按照提示完成邮箱验证。
初始化GitHub仓库
在创建了账号后,接下来要做的是初始化一个新的GitHub仓库。这是你网站文件存放的地方。
- 登录GitHub后,点击右上角的“+”按钮,然后选择“New repository”。
- 在“Repository name”栏中输入你的仓库名(通常使用你的用户名.github.io)。
- 选择公共或私人仓库。
- 勾选“Initialize this repository with a README”,然后点击“Create repository”。
使用GitHub Pages托管网站
一旦仓库创建成功,你可以开始使用GitHub Pages来托管你的网站。下面是设置的步骤:
- 在你新创建的仓库页面,点击“Settings”。
- 滚动到“GitHub Pages”部分。
- 在“Source”下拉菜单中,选择“main”或“master”分支,然后点击“Save”。
- 你的网站将在几分钟后通过
https://你的用户名.github.io
访问。
上传网站内容
准备你的网页文件
你需要有一些网页文件,通常是HTML、CSS和JavaScript文件。可以手动创建一个简单的网页:
index.html
:网页的主文件。style.css
:网页样式文件。
上传文件到仓库
- 在你的仓库页面,点击“Add file”,然后选择“Upload files”。
- 将你准备好的网页文件拖拽到上传框中。
- 提交更改,填写提交信息,然后点击“Commit changes”。
自定义你的网页
在上传完文件后,你可以开始自定义你的网站:
- 修改
index.html
文件来添加自己的内容。 - 使用CSS调整网页样式。
- 使用JavaScript实现互动功能。
查看网站
完成所有步骤后,打开浏览器并访问https://你的用户名.github.io
,你应该能看到你创建的网页了!
常见问题解答
GitHub Pages支持哪些文件格式?
GitHub Pages主要支持HTML、CSS和JavaScript文件,其他文件格式如图片、PDF等也可以一并上传。
如何将自定义域名与GitHub Pages绑定?
- 在你的GitHub Pages仓库中,进入“Settings”页面。
- 在“Custom domain”中输入你的自定义域名。
- 按照指引设置DNS记录,通常是CNAME记录指向你的GitHub Pages网址。
GitHub Pages是否收费?
GitHub Pages是免费的,允许用户托管公共仓库。对于私人仓库,只有GitHub Pro用户可以使用此功能。
如何更新我的网站内容?
你可以直接在GitHub网站上编辑文件,或者使用Git工具克隆仓库到本地修改,然后再推送到远程仓库。
结语
通过以上步骤,你已经学会了如何用GitHub创建个人网站。无论是展示个人作品,还是记录学习历程,GitHub Pages都能满足你的需求。希望你能利用这一平台,创造出独一无二的网络空间!
正文完